BASIC FUNCTION:
The Business Development Manager is responsible for developing and executing strategies to generate revenue through business partnerships, endorsements, marketing agreements, and corporate sponsorships. This role focuses on identifying, developing, and managing relationships with vendors and partners while supporting revenue growth initiatives aligned with member hospital needs.
The Manager will maintain and grow an existing portfolio of partnerships, identify new opportunities, and support the development and promotion of service lines. This position requires a highly organized, relationship-driven professional with strong communication skills and the ability to translate insights into actionable business opportunities.
